I still like the game and bet on a regular basis. Over the years I have wagered on a variation of chemin de fer called "The Take it Leave it Method". You definitely will not get rich with this tactic or beat the casino, nonetheless you will have an abundance of fun. This method is founded on the idea that 21 seems to be a game of runs. When you’re hot your on fire, and when you are not you are NOT!

I gamble with basic strategy chemin de fer. When I do not win I bet the lowest amount allowed on the subsequent hand. If I don’t win again I bet the lowest amount allowed on the next hand again etc. As soon as I hit I take the winnings paid to me and I bet the original bet again. If I win this hand I then leave the winnings paid to me and now have double my original bet on the table. If I succeed again I take the payout paid to me, and if I win the next hand I leave it for a total of four times my original bet. I keep wagering this way "Take it Leave it etc". Once I lose I return the action back down to the original bet.

I am very strict and never back out. It gets very thrilling at times. If you succeed at a few hands in a row your bets go up very quick. Before you know it you are betting $100-200/ hand. You need to comprehend that you can relinquish a lot faster this way too!. But it really makes the game more exciting. And you will be amazed at the streaks you see gamble this way. Here is a guide of what you would bet if you continue winning at a $5 game.

Bet 5 dollar
Take 5 dollar paid-out to you, leave the initial $5 bet

Bet $5
Leave $5 paid to you for a total bet of ten dollar

Bet ten dollar
Take $10 paid to you, leave the initial $10 wager

Bet 10 dollar
Leave 10 dollar paid-out to you for a total wager of $20

Bet twenty dollar
Take $20 paid-out to you, leave the first $20 bet

Bet 20 dollar
Leave twenty dollar paid-out to you for a total wager of $40

Bet $40
Take $40 paid to you, leave the original 40 dollar bet

Bet forty dollar
Leave 40 dollar paid to you for a total wager of $80

Wager eighty dollar
Take eighty dollar paid-out to you, leave the first eighty dollar bet

Wager $80
Leave $80 paid-out to you for a total bet of one hundred and sixty dollar

Bet $160
Take $160 paid to you, leave the original 160 dollar wager

If you left at this moment you would be up $315 !!

It’s hard to go on a run this long, but it occasionally happen. And when it does you can’t alter and lower your wager or the final result won’t be the same.
